Summary
Experienced professional to interpret retirement laws, administer plans, and manage benefit records. One year specialized experience required.
We are seeking a highly qualified professional with specialized experience in retirement benefits. This role requires at least one year of full-time (35-40 hours/week) work experience comparable to a GS-11 level in the federal government.
Key Responsibilities:
- Interpret retirement laws and policies to resolve benefit issues and guide staff.
- Administer defined contribution retirement plans, ensuring accurate and compliant benefit delivery.
- Review and manage recordkeeping systems for compliance with legal and policy requirements.
- Coordinate with internal and external stakeholders to support innovation and align benefit services with program goals.
